What Is Full Stack Development?

In the full stack vs cyber security comparison, full stack developement focuses on creating complete web applications. A full stack developer works on frontend design, backend programming, databases, APIs, and deployment to ensure websites run smoothly. This career is ideal for learners who enjoy coding, problem-solving, and building digital products. What Is Cyber Security?

When comparing full stack vs cyber security, cyber security focuses on protecting systems, networks, and sensitive data from online threats. It includes network security, ethical hacking, data protection, threat detection, and risk management to reduce security risks. This field is ideal for learners who enjoy solving security challenges, analyzing vulnerabilities, and protecting digital information in today’s technology-driven world.

Full Stack Developer Salary in India

The salary of a Full Stack Developer in India depends on technical expertise, hands-on project experience, industry demand, and the employer. Professionals with strong frontend, backend, database, and cloud skills generally receive higher salary packages.

Full Stack Developer Salary by Experience

Experience Average Salary (Per Annum)
Fresher (0–2 Years) ₹3–6 LPA
2–4 Years ₹6–10 LPA
5+ Years ₹12–20+ LPA

Factors That Affect Full Stack Developer Salary

Technical Skills

Expertise in React, Angular, Node.js, Java, Python, APIs, and cloud technologies.

Company

Product-based companies and multinational organizations often offer higher salary packages.

Location

Metro cities such as Bengaluru, Hyderabad, Pune, Mumbai, and Gurgaon generally pay more.

Projects & Experience

A strong portfolio with real-world projects can improve salary prospects.

Certifications

Industry-recognized certifications and continuous upskilling increase earning potential.

Cyber Security Salary in India

The demand for Cyber Security professionals is increasing as organizations invest more in protecting their systems, networks, and sensitive data. Salaries vary based on technical expertise, certifications, specialization, and practical experience.

Cyber Security Salary by Experience

Experience Average Salary (Per Annum)
Fresher (0–2 Years) ₹4–7 LPA
2–4 Years ₹7–12 LPA
5+ Years ₹12–25+ LPA

Factors That Affect Cyber Security Salary

Cyber Security Skills

Knowledge of ethical hacking, penetration testing, cloud security, SIEM tools, and incident response.

Professional Certifications

CEH, CompTIA Security+, CISSP, and CISM certifications improve earning potential.

Industry

Banking, finance, healthcare, cloud computing, and government sectors often offer competitive salaries.

Experience & Specialization

Cloud security, digital forensics, malware analysis, and security architecture specialists earn more.

Location

Major IT hubs in India generally provide better salary packages than smaller cities.

2. Is Full Stack Development easier than Cyber Security?

Full Stack Development mainly focuses on programming and web technologies, while Cyber Security requires knowledge of networking, operating systems, and security concepts. The learning difficulty depends on your interests and technical background.

3. Which career offers a higher salary in India?

Both careers offer competitive salaries. Full Stack Developers typically earn between ₹3–20+ LPA, while Cyber Security professionals can earn ₹4–25+ LPA depending on their experience, skills, certifications, and employer.

4. Do I need coding skills for Cyber Security?

Basic programming knowledge is helpful in Cyber Security, especially for automation, scripting, and penetration testing. However, the amount of coding required depends on the specific cybersecurity role.
